The term “temperature rise” in reference to a furnace, whether in a commercial building or a residential space, pertains to the difference between the temperature of the air going into the furnace and the temperature of the air coming out. Understanding this parameter is critical to achieving optimal furnace performance and operation, ensuring energy efficiency, and maintaining a comfortable indoor environment.
In more technical terms, temperature rise is calculated by subtracting the return air temperature from the supply air temperature. For instance, if the air entering the furnace is 70 degrees Fahrenheit and the air exiting is 120 degrees Fahrenheit, the temperature rise would be 50 degrees. This information is essential because it helps determine if your furnace is operating within its designed range.
It’s worth noting that each furnace is designed to have a specific temperature rise, typically indicated on the nameplate details of the unit. If the temperature rise in your furnace exceeds or falls short of this specified range, it could be indicative of several issues. These could range from airflow problems due to dirty filters or blocked vents, to more serious concerns like a malfunctioning heat exchanger.
In a commercial building context, maintaining an appropriate temperature rise is even more crucial. Given the larger size and more complex HVAC systems in these buildings, an incorrect temperature rise could significantly impact energy consumption and costs. It could also lead to uneven heating across different parts of the building, resulting in discomfort for occupants and potential harm to temperature-sensitive equipment or materials.
